Willemstad, 06 September 2011 – Approximately a year ago, Curacao reminded the entire world of the uniqueness of this small island in the Caribbean, when Substation Curacao opened its doors to the public with the most unique attraction in the world, a 5-person submarine that takes you to depths beyond Scuba diving limits. Today we added a new piece of technology to enhance our operation − an underwater camera mounted permanently on the Sea Aquarium reef. Everyone can now become part of this adventure when the Curasub descends daily to the abyss. Through this camera our passengers will have the unique opportunity to send a live personal message to their family and friends around the world!

And for those that can’t afford a trip with the submarine, we are auctioning some of our special trips on Ebay, such as one that goes to 1,000 ft. deep.  For just $350, you could be a lucky winner for one of our unique trips.  With our auction we want to give everyone the opportunity to be able to experience one of our deep sea expeditions. On the 1,000-ft dive you will go beyond the average tourist dives and be part of our scientific hunts for new species.

DISCOVER THE ISLAND OF CURAÇAO WITH AIR CANADA’S NEW, NON-STOP WEEKLY SERVICE

NEW Saturday Flights Make Curaçao More Accessible to Canadians

WILLEMSTAD, CURAÇAO – September 19, 2011 –Air Canada will launch weekly, non-stop service to Curaçao International Airport (CUR) from Toronto Pearson International Airport (YYZ) on Saturday, Dec. 24, 2011.

Travelers can book now to take advantage of the inaugural Air Canada flight, departing Toronto at 10:05 a.m. and arriving in Curaçao at 4:20 p.m. starting on Dec. 24, 2011. The flight schedule is as follows:

“We are excited to announce the launch of Air Canada’s first non-stop flight from Toronto to Curaçao,” said André Rojer, Curaçao Tourist Board Marketing Manager North America.

“The new non-stop flight brings huge potential for growth in arrivals from Canada, which remain consistently steady with tourism arrivals to date, year over year. We anticipate this new flight on Air Canada will increase demand for Curaçao in the Canadian marketplace and open the door to a new wave of first time visitors.”

Coral Spawning

One of the best experiences I ever had!!

After 3 days monitoring September 18th was spawning night. The nights before some pre-spawning. During the spawning we were surrounded by lots of fishes.

A group of researchers (SECORE) with special nets we collected egg and sperm cells (from the coral montastraea faveolata), so they can do the fertilization in the Curacao Sea Aquarium.

Later when the larves are settled they will be put back on the reef.

I feel so lucky that I was able to be a volunteer in such an important research, everything was posible thanks to CURious2dive, a local dive shop who’s working and helping SECORE on the research and preservation of this beatiful reef.

Thanks to all the volunteers who joined CURious2DIVE to help make this project a succes.
